01 · What is KPV?

KPV is a three-amino-acid peptide (Lys-Pro-Val) corresponding to residues 11-13 of α-MSH. It is one of the shortest peptides in the anti-inflammatory-peptide literature.

02 · Mechanism of action

KPV attenuates NF-κB activation and inflammatory cytokine output in preclinical gastrointestinal and dermal models. Notably, its anti-inflammatory activity is preserved in melanocortin-receptor knock-out mice, indicating that the mechanism is at least partly receptor-independent — likely through direct intracellular effects on the NF-κB pathway. It is the anti-inflammatory component of the KLOW blend.

03 · Handling, reconstitution and storage

Lyophilised KPV is stored at -20 °C, desiccated, protected from light. Once reconstituted with bacteriostatic water (0.9 % benzyl alcohol) the peptide is generally regarded as stable for up to 28 days at 2–8 °C, provided the vial is not warmed repeatedly or exposed to direct light.

Bring the vial to room temperature before opening, inject the diluent slowly against the vial wall, swirl gently to dissolve — never shake — and log the reconstitution date on the vial. 04 · Purity, identity and CoA expectations

For reference-grade KPV, expect: reverse-phase HPLC area-percent purity ≥ 99.0 %, mass-spectrometry identity confirmation matching the theoretical monoisotopic mass, water content by Karl Fischer where relevant, and bacterial endotoxin / bioburden reports for material intended for animal work. Every certificate should carry a batch number, manufacture date and retest date.

05 · Regulatory context

KPV has no marketing authorisation as a medicine in the UK, US or EU. It is supplied as a laboratory reagent only.

Frequently asked questions

Is KPV the same as α-MSH?

No. KPV is the three-amino-acid C-terminal fragment of α-MSH. It keeps the anti-inflammatory activity of the parent hormone but loses the pigmentary and cardiovascular activity.

What is KPV used for in preclinical research?

Most-referenced applications are models of colitis, atopic dermatitis and wound-healing inflammation, where KPV attenuates NF-κB signalling and inflammatory cytokine output.
